Negotiation Tips
- Get a pre-purchase inspection before buying any used car in Atlanta — it costs $100–200 and can save you thousands.
- Always check the vehicle history report (Carfax or AutoCheck) for accidents, title issues, and service records.
- The trade-in value for this vehicle is approximately $28,279. Use this as your floor when negotiating.
- The private party price is around $31,172 — buying from a private seller typically saves 10–15% vs a dealer.
- Check for open recalls at nhtsa.gov — dealers must fix recalls for free regardless of where you bought the car.
- This model holds its value exceptionally well — expect less room for negotiation, but also less depreciation after purchase.
